2013 Ethicon Endo Surgery (Albuquerque, NM) Engineering Summer/Fall Co-op(Job Number: 00000986)

Description

Ethicon Endo-Surgery, a member of Johnson & Johnson Family of Companies, is recruiting for Engineering Co-ops located in Albuquerque, New Mexico.

Ethicon Endo-Surgery develops and markets advanced medical devices for minimally invasive and open surgical procedures, focusing on procedure-enabling devices for the interventional diagnosis and treatment of conditions in general and bariatric surgery, as well as gastrointestinal health, gynecology and surgical oncology. More information can be found at the new company website www.ethiconendosurgery.com.

As a Co-op at Ethicon Endo-Surgery, you will support projects within the department that you are assigned. There are Supply Chain Operations opportunities in Facilities, Manufacturing, Packaging, and Technical Services. Co-op experience is of varied complexity commensurate with the student's level of experience. The Co-op must follow all company safety policies and other safety precautions within the work area, and will work under the direct supervision of a manufacturing engineer.

The Co-op program is focused on providing college students with practical business experience. It allows them to develop leadership skills, broaden their understanding of the concepts learned in school and obtain industry experience. The Co-op program participants will be better able to apply concepts learned in the classroom and will be able to ask more poignant questions of their professors to further their goals and education.

The Summer/Fall Co-op is June/July - December 2013.

Qualifications


Candidate must be enrolled (not necessarily taking classes) in an accredited college/university and be in good academic standing pursuing at least a Bachelors Degree in Engineering. Mechanical Engineering, Electrical Engineering, Chemical Engineering, or Logistics/Planning/Supply Chain academic majors are preferred. Only students who have completed their freshman year or above will be considered. A minimum G.P.A. of 3.0 is preferred. Demonstrated leadership/participation in campus programs and/or community service activities is preferred. Availability to work full-time (40 hours/week) during the Summer/Fall (June/July - December 2013) Co-op is required.

These Co-op positions are located in Albuquerque, New Mexico. Students must be able to provide their own transportation to this location. A stipend will be offered to students that meet the commuting distance eligibility requirements. Candidates must be legally authorized to work in the United States and not require future sponsorship for employment visa status (e.g. H1-B status) now or in the future.
